Begin with the course number, term dates, required practice setting, mentor or preceptor credentials, location limits, and every form your program expects. If the course includes both a scholarly project and direct-care practice, separate those needs so each proposed person and site can be evaluated for the work they will actually supervise.
A DNP scholarly project needs a practice setting where the student can examine a real care or systems problem, introduce an approved change, and evaluate results. Suitable settings may include health systems, hospitals, clinics, public health programs, long-term care organizations, or community services. The right setting depends on the approved project question, access to the intended population, and the site's capacity to support the work.

The national DNP framework starts with at least 1,000 supervised post-baccalaureate practice hours. A student's remaining hours cannot be calculated from that floor alone because programs differ on pathway design and qualifying prior master's work. Use California Baptist University's current degree audit and course plan to establish the approved balance before a search begins.
For a direct-care pathway, the plan may require a board-certified nurse practitioner or physician in the student's population focus. Systems and leadership hours may call for a different practice expert and setting.
